To selection in MBA programme one must clear an enterance exam of desired management college.
There are many good management college in India, mostly all tier 2, 3 and all IIM accept CAT score. There are some other good college that accepting exams like CMAT, XAT, MAH MBA CET, etc. they are amongst the most the toughest entrance exams in India. Selection criteria is starts with CAT score, 10th and 12th std percentage, candidate's CGPA in graduation degree is also important and mostly first three years are important.
For top college like IIM students have to required percentile above 95 in CAT but in exams like XAT 90 percentile

The fee for MBA at Junagadh Agricultural University is Rs. 56,500 and the eligibility criteria for admission is the candidate should have a bachelor’s degree (minimum 4 years) in Agriculture or Agriculture allied Science with 60% or equivalent (50% for SC/ST/SEBC/Physically challenged candidate alone) from a recognised educational institution.
